Driving Too Young

The minister of a well-attended, strong, and enthusiastic
church often showed himself ready and able to deal with any
situation that might come up. One Sunday, just as the
minister was reaching the climax of his sermon, his own
young son entered the church, ran to the center aisle,
started making loud beeps and brrrmms like a car without a
muffler, then zoomed right toward him.

The minister stopped his sermon, pointed severely at his
son, and commanded, "Jimmy, park the car immediately beside
your mother on that bench (pointing), turn off the ignition,
and hand her the keys."

The sermon continued undisturbed... after a good laugh by
the congregation.
